AMD Announces Ryzen 7800X3D, 7900X3D, and 7950X3D

These is perhaps the processors you have come to count on as they may provide the proper mixture of bottlenecked video games and graphics playing cards and boosted gaming efficiency, because of first rate single-threaded efficiency, glorious multi-threaded efficiency, and X3D cache.

At the very least three Ryzen 7000 X3D fashions can have 8, 12 and 16 cores respectively. AMD introduced it at CES 2023, although the processors will not be accessible till February. X3D processors include the producer’s personal 3D V-Cache stacked on high of a CPU chip, along with the cache present in Ryzen 7000 CPUs. Due to this fact, new CPUs have an elevated L3 cache measurement of 64 MB.

Whereas the present Ryzen 7 5800X3D remains to be a premium CPU possibility for avid gamers, Ryzen 7000 X3D parts will profit much more from 3D V-Cache because of the elevated bandwidth risk, thus bettering their efficiency in video games, rendering workloads and functions. . Curiously, AMD launched three Ryzen 7000X3D fashions with 3D V-Cache, growing the variety of X3D CPUs from one (within the case of the Ryzen 5000 household) to a few (for the Ryzen 7000 sequence) for consumer PCs.

All three processors have a TDP of 120 W, which brings these processors again to extra manageable temperatures. All of the elements mixed may make these processors essentially the most fascinating processor of the yr for the gaming finish client. The caches are fascinating, the Twin-CCD 7900X3D and 7950X3D have been proven with their respective caches of 140MB and 144MB. Because of this one CCD has 32 MB of L3 cache on the die and the opposite is an ordinary planar CCD.

Additionally new is the truth that “X3D” would not all the time imply decrease turbo clock speeds. At the very least the 2 main fashions not lose their most turbo velocity in comparison with their X siblings: AMD continues to specify the Ryzen 9 7950X as much as 5.7GHz and the Ryzen 9 7900X3D as much as 5.6GHz. The utmost clock velocity of the Ryzen 7 7800X3D is 5.0 GHz whereas the utmost clock velocity of the Ryzen 7 7700X is 5.4 GHz. The rationale for Ryzen 9’s excessive turbo is that the cache chip is carried by just one chip. AMD additionally set a TDP of 120 watts for all three X3D CPUs. That is greater than the 105 watts of the Ryzen 7 7700X, however lower than the 170 watts of the 2 present Ryzen 9s out of the field. The step is sensible in mild of the meant utility of X3D CPUs.

AMD launched its Zen 4-based Ryzen 7000 sequence desktop processors in September 2022. They’ve glorious single-threaded efficiency (thanks partially to their ultra-fast clock speeds), which implies they will compete nicely towards Intel’s twelfth and thirteenth era elements. AMD claims its Ryzen 7000X3D processors are 13–24% quicker than Intel’s Core i9-13900K processor in early benchmarks. The Ryzen 7800X3D, then again, is 21-30% quicker than the Ryzen 7 5800X3D in 4 video games examined by AMD. The corporate additionally claims that the brand new processors outperform the earlier Ryzen 7 5800X3D in inventive workloads. The launch of the processors is scheduled for February. To this point, AMD has not offered a urged retail worth or introduced when its merchandise might be accessible.
